THE ONE WEDDING COLLECTION

Celebrate your big day in timeless style with THE ONE WEDDING COLLECTION from Roehampton Flowers. Thoughtfully designed for modern couples, this premium wedding flower package brings fresh, elegant blooms to every key moment of your celebration. Choose from three curated options tailored to your guest list: the Intimate Package (50-75 guests) with 1 bridal bouquet, 3 bridesmaid bouquets and 4 groom boutonnieres; the Original Package (75-100 guests) with 1 bridal bouquet, 5 bridesmaid bouquets and 6 groom boutonnieres; or the Ultimate Package (100+ guests) with 1 bridal bouquet, 7 bridesmaid bouquets and 8 groom boutonnieres. Each arrangement is handcrafted by our expert florists in Roehampton to complement your wedding theme, colour palette and venue style. Using only fresh, high-quality flowers, we create romantic, photo-ready designs that look beautiful from the aisle to the evening reception.
